7. You would need to check the price format in broker's statement VS MAF's

If the price format is different from MAF's mapping product market data format, you need to make adjustment in the data mapping table:

  1. If broker price format is the same as MAF price format, use 1 as multiplier (input 1 in Price Format)
  2. If broker price format is different from MAF price format,
    1. e.g., gold price from TT is 20123
    2. MAF gold price is 2010.3
    3. then we use 0.1 as multiplier (input in Price Format) to convert broker price format to MAF price format
